0
我知道可以跨多个数据库进行连接,但是我想知道数据库是否位于不同的计算机上,这是可能的。如果这是可能的 - 性能会受损吗?MySQL:跨不同计算机上的多个数据库加入
我知道可以跨多个数据库进行连接,但是我想知道数据库是否位于不同的计算机上,这是可能的。如果这是可能的 - 性能会受损吗?MySQL:跨不同计算机上的多个数据库加入
这取决于。
我以前在MSSQL/SQL-Server中使用链接服务器,并且将一个表连接到另一个表上的另一台计算机可能会非常慢,这取决于数据量。
我建议的是,你首先从远程计算机中选择具有适当过滤器的数据到临时表中。将此临时表加入到本地表中。这通常会大大加快速度。